Heads up: if the Nightloom backfill scheduler shows jobs stuck in PENDING, it's almost always the cron shard lock left over from a cancelled run. Clear the lock via the admin task, not by hand-editing the table — that bit a contractor last quarter at Verrow Analytics. Re-trigger from the dashboard afterward. When filing a ticket, always include the scheduler build token shown below.

build token for kagaf-hahof: htk14_9d3d4d26d7d8de

## Undo/Redo — Sketchforge diagram editor

Undo is command-based, not snapshot-based. Each edit pushes an inverse op onto a bounded stack; redo is cleared on any new edit. Ops within the coalesce window merge (e.g., repeated drags). Stack depth, coalesce window, and the memory ceiling are the only knobs — don't add more without a design review. Current constants are as follows.

tuning table, kajog-kawef:
PRIORITIES = {
    "kelox": 870,
    "kasix": 89,
    "eliax": 988,
}

**Quarterly Planning Note: Dravelin Components Contract Renewal**

The supply agreement with Dravelin Components expires at quarter-end. Negotiations have secured a two-year extension with volume discounts on the Ostermane line, pending legal review. Department heads should confirm forecast quantities by Friday to lock pricing tiers. The confidential note on related business plans appears below.

board note of bawep-tajef: Queniusek Systems plans to raise the Quenvan list price by 53.1 percent in March. The pricing group signed off on a budget of $176.4 million for Project Drueth. The renewal with Casionix Partners closes at $142.5 million a year, 8.3 percent below the last contract. Project Fraax slips by six weeks because of the tooling delay.

MEMO — Reseller Programme Handover

To the incoming director: the Brightmere reseller programme currently covers 42 partners across three regions. Tier discounts were last revised in spring; margins are holding but the Kesswick channel is underperforming. Quarterly reviews are led by Priya, with compliance checks handled centrally. Full partner files are in the shared drive. One item requires discretion before your first partner call.

internal memo for yahag-hahig: Belwynix Group plans to lower the Silir list price by 62 percent in May.